Introduction To Private Student Loans

Private student loans play a pivotal role in higher education funding. They serve as a critical resource for students needing additional financial support beyond what federal options provide. Private loans often fill the gap left after grants, scholarships, and federal loans.

Distinguishing between federal and private student loans is crucial. Federal loans offer fixed interest rates and income-driven repayment plans. Private loans, on the other hand, come from banks, credit unions, and other financial institutions. They might offer variable rates and require credit checks.

Federal Loans Private Loans
Fixed interest rates Variable rates possible
Income-driven repayment options Credit-based eligibility
Subsidized options available More lender choices

Interest Rates And Terms Offered

Interest rates on private student loans vary by lender. Fixed rates remain constant over time. Variable rates can fluctuate with market conditions. Students must decide which rate type suits their financial situation.

Loan repayment terms define the payment period and conditions. Shorter terms often lead to higher monthly payments but less interest over time. Longer terms reduce monthly payments but increase total interest paid.

Rate Type Pros Cons
Fixed Rate Predictable payments Initially higher than variable
Variable Rate Lower start rates Potential rate increase

Evaluating Loan Fees And Additional Costs

Evaluating loan fees and additional costs is crucial for students seeking financial aid. Origination fees are charged by lenders to process a new loan. These fees can add a significant cost to the borrower’s expense. Some lenders might not charge these fees, offering a more attractive option.

Another aspect to consider is prepayment penalties. These are fees charged if you pay off your loan early. Not all loans have these penalties, but it’s important to check.

Late payment impacts are also worth noting. These can lead to additional charges and affect your credit score. It’s vital to understand the terms of late payments before signing a loan agreement.

Fee Type Description Typical Cost
Origination Fee Charged for loan processing Varies by lender
Prepayment Penalty Fee for early repayment Depends on loan terms
Late Payment Fee Charged when payment is late May affect credit score

Eligibility Requirements

Eligibility requirements for private student loans often focus on credit score and income. A good credit score shows you can pay back the loan. Many lenders want to see a strong score. Your income must prove you can cover monthly payments. Sometimes, students don’t meet these criteria.

A co-signer can help in such cases. This person agrees to pay your loan if you can’t. They must have a good credit score and stable income. This makes lenders more likely to give you the loan. Remember, choosing a reliable co-signer is key. They take on a big responsibility.

Repayment Assistance And Forbearance Options

Students seeking private student loans should consider the repayment flexibility offered by lenders. Forbearance options are critical during unforeseen financial hardships. These options allow temporary suspension of payments. Terms vary, so it’s essential to understand the specifics.

Some lenders offer hardship assistance programs. They provide tailored support, like reduced payments. This assistance can be invaluable for borrowers facing challenges. Refinancing Opportunities

Refinancing student loans can be a smart move. Students should consider it after graduation, especially when they have a stable job and good credit score. This can lead to lower interest rates and reduced monthly payments.

Be aware of the possible downsides. Refinancing federal loans means losing benefits like income-driven repayment plans and potential loan forgiveness programs. It’s important to weigh these factors carefully.

Pros Cons
Lower interest rates Loss of federal loan benefits
Reduced monthly payments Requires good credit score
Single monthly payment May extend loan term

Frequently Asked Questions

What Are Private Student Loans?

Private student loans are education loans offered by banks, credit unions, and other private lenders instead of the federal government. They help cover college expenses not fully met by scholarships, grants, or federal loans, typically requiring credit and income review for eligibility.

How Do I Choose The Best Private Student Loan?

Choosing the best private student loan involves comparing interest rates, repayment terms, and lender benefits. Look for loans with low interest rates, flexible repayment options, and no origination fees. It’s also wise to consider the lender’s customer service reputation.

What’s The Difference Between Fixed And Variable Rates?

Fixed-rate loans have the same interest rate for the loan’s duration, offering predictable monthly payments. Variable-rate loans can fluctuate over time based on market conditions, potentially leading to lower initial rates but unpredictable future payments.

Can I Refinance Private Student Loans?

Yes, you can refinance private student loans. Refinancing involves taking out a new loan to pay off one or more existing loans, potentially securing a lower interest rate or more favorable terms. It’s a strategic move for borrowers with strong credit histories and stable incomes.
